Transaction 04859fdce05bbdabd950840dcde613391883010650219fac6a16c9589be881ad
1 Input
1 Output
-
04859fdce05bbdabd950840dcde613391883010650219fac6a16c9589be881ad:0
- value
- 1950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e369989bab673f358b044caebf32e0e996be1707 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MjStVbBJQGDcFufihY6L9ACbsS13ge2eh